The Cost of a Trip Between Ashland, Virginia and Summerville, South Carolina

Introduction

Planning a trip can be exciting, but it's essential to consider all the factors, including the cost. If you're considering a journey between Ashland, Virginia, and Summerville, South Carolina, understanding the different possible routes and their associated costs is crucial. In this article, we delve into the various route options and highlight the expenses and distances involved to help you make an informed decision.

Route Options

Route 1: I-95 South

The most straightforward and commonly traveled route from Ashland to Summerville is via Interstate 95 South. This direct interstate route covers approximately 400 miles and takes approximately seven hours, depending on traffic and other conditions. The advantage of choosing this route is its efficiency and directness.

Cost Analysis

When it comes to calculating the cost of a road trip, fuel expenses play a significant role. The average fuel efficiency for most cars is around 25 miles per gallon (mpg) on highways. Based on the distance of 400 miles to cover, and assuming a gas price of $2.85 per gallon, the estimated fuel cost for this trip would be:

Fuel Cost = (Distance / Miles per gallon) * Price per gallon
Fuel Cost = (400 / 25) * $2.85 = $45.60

Keep in mind that this is just an estimate and can vary based on your vehicle's actual fuel efficiency and the current gas prices.
